Unit 3A, 6 Frank Searle Passage, London E17 6ET, United Kingdom , Great Britain (UK)
Pakistan
2015 Fairview Blvd, USA
130 Jordan Dr, Chattanooga, TN 37421, USA
2121 Innovation Blvd F, Hutto, TX 78634, USA
11 Town Square Place .S - 1203 Jersey City, NJ 07310, USA
1, 3rd floor, 2nd cross, 80 Feet Rd, KR Garden, Koramangala, Bengaluru, Karnataka 560034, India
1365 Weston Rd, York, ON M6M 4R9, Canada
743 Brannon Street Los Angeles CA 90026, USA
Serving Area, Netherlands